2-Hydroxynicotinic acid(Cas 609-71-2) Usage

Definition

ChEBI: 2-Hydroxynicotinic acid is a member of pyridines and an aromatic carboxylic acid. It is a derivative of nicotinic acid, was found to exist in four polymorphs. It is used as a growth factor in Erwinia amylovora growth (pear and apple blossoms).
